John Lennon's killer is denied parole for the 6th time

Mark David Chapman, John Lennon's killer, was denied parole for the sixth time Tuesday, according to the New York State Division of Parole.

A three-member panel of parole board commissioners conducted a video conference interview with Chapman from their offices in Rochester.

Chapman's latest request for freedom comes just months short of the 30th anniversary of the death of the former member of the Beatles....
